Improv Tonight! is a fast, funny, and completely unscripted monthly comedy show featuring different improv teams every Friday and Saturday night. Each team performs two shows—one at 8:00 PM and one at 10:00 PM—and no two shows are ever the same.
Family Dinner is an all femme long form narrative improv troupe based in Asheville, NC. Its members have studied and performed in Chicago and Los Angeles at Second City, iO Theater, Impro Theater, just to name a few. They also teach and perform in Asheville with Misfit Improv and Acting School and Adesto Theater. They will improvise a play full of secrets decided by the audience right before your eyes!
